Règles

If Scotland and Brazil combined record at least 7+ corners during the entire game (regulation, stoppage and any extra time periods) of the Scotland vs Brazil professional FIFA World Cup soccer game originally scheduled for Jun 24, 2026, then the market resolves to Yes.

Kalshi
  • If the game is cancelled or rescheduled to over two weeks away, the market will resolve to a fair price in accordance with the rules.
  • If Scotland and Brazil combined record at least 8+ corners during the entire game (regulation, stoppage and any extra time periods) of the Scotland vs Brazil professional FIFA World Cup soccer game originally scheduled for Jun 24, 2026, then the market resolves to Yes.
  • If Scotland and Brazil combined record at least 9+ corners during the entire game (regulation, stoppage and any extra time periods) of the Scotland vs Brazil professional FIFA World Cup soccer game originally scheduled for Jun 24, 2026, then the market resolves to Yes.
  • If Scotland and Brazil combined record at least 10+ corners during the entire game (regulation, stoppage and any extra time periods) of the Scotland vs Brazil professional FIFA World Cup soccer game originally scheduled for Jun 24, 2026, then the market resolves to Yes.
  • If Scotland and Brazil combined record at least 11+ corners during the entire game (regulation, stoppage and any extra time periods) of the Scotland vs Brazil professional FIFA World Cup soccer game originally scheduled for Jun 24, 2026, then the market resolves to Yes.
